The purpose of the study is to evaluate the efficacy and safety of postoperative adjuvant chemotherapy with PD-1 inhibitors and chemoradiotherapy, in comparison with adjuvant chemotherapy only, in D2/R0 resected pN3 gastric or gastroesophageal junction adenocarcinoma. PD-1+CRT cohort: A total of 216 patients will receive 6 weeks of PD-1 inhibitors and chemotherapy, then receive concurrent chemoradiotherapy, followed by 6 weeks of PD-1 inhibitors and chemotherapy, finally receive maintenance treatment of PD-1 inhibitors until (maximum 1year after radiotherapy). CT cohort: A total of 217 patients will receive 6 months of chemotherapy. The disease-free survival(DFS), overall survival(OS) and adverse effects will be analyzed.

| Label | Type | Description | Intervention Names |
|---|---|---|---|
| PD-1 inhibitor and chemoradiotherapy | Experimental | PD-1 inhibitor+CapeOX/SOX/FOLFOX for 6 weeks, followed by chemoradiotherapy; 6 weeks of PD-1 inhibitor and CapeOX/SOX/FOLFOX for 6 weeks after chemoradiotherapy, followed by PD-1 inhibitor, till 12 months after chemoradiotherapy. PD-1 inhibitor Nivolumab/Toripalimab 240mg solution intravenously once daily, Q2W. OR Nivolumab/Toripalimab 360mg solution intravenously once daily, Q3W; OR Pembrolizumab/Tilelizumab/Sintilimab/Carrelizumab, 200mg solution intravenously once daily, Q3W. Chemotherapy: CapeOx or SOX or FOLFOX therapy determined by investigator. Chemoradiotherapy Radiotherapy: 1.8 Gy/fx, 45-50.5Gy Chemotherapy: Capecitabine 625mg/m2 bid orally with radiotherapy; OR Tegafur-gimeracil-oteracil potassium combination drug 40-60mg bid orally with radiotherapy. |
|
| Chemotherapy | Active Comparator | Chemotherapy: CapeOx or SOX or FOLFOX therapy determined by investigator. CapeOX: Oxaliplatin 130 mg/m2 (body surface area) solution intravenously once-daily, followed by 20 days off. Capecitabine 1000 mg2 (body surface area) bid orally in 14 days, followed by 7 days off. SOX: Oxaliplatin 130 mg/m2 (body surface area) solution intravenously once-daily, followed by 20 days off. Tegafur-gimeracil-oteracil potassium combination drug 40 - 60 mg bid orally in 14 days, followed by 7 days off. FOLFOX: Oxaliplatin 85 mg/m2 (body surface area) solution intravenously once-daily, followed by 13 days off. 5-FU 2400-2800mg/m2/d continuous intravenous pumping for 48h, Q2W. |

| Measure | Description | Time Frame |
|---|---|---|
| 3-year DFS rate | Defined as the time from randomization to the date of first documented progression or death from any cause. | Up to 3 years |
| Measure | Description | Time Frame |
|---|---|---|
| 3-year OS rate | Defined as the time from randomization to death from any cause. | Up to 3 years |
| 3-year local recurrence free survival rate | Defined as the time from randomization to the date of first documented recurrence or death from any cause. |
